A pair of Derby ice pails and covers, c 1790, with gilt shell handles, painted by William Billingsley with bouquets and scattered flowers, liners, 22cm h, painted puce mark, 80 and painter's long tailed numeral 7 inside the footrim
Good condition, slight surface scratches.
